Re: fenderwell CAI

Post by ranx93 on Sat Jul 23, 2011 9:10 pm

i have a UPR fenderwell CAI BUT.. with your setup almost identical to mine minus the blower, ignition sys and fuel the car ran like poop with the fenderwell intake because of the bend in the pipe before the MAF. it worked good when it was a stocker. I would save up and get a Anderson N/A Power Pipe from AndersonFordsport.com itll move your MAF sensor into the fenderwell with the air filter with no bends before the MAF. Plus it looks better. my car idled perfect, ran much much better and pulled harder with it.

then your maf wasn't calibrated for cold air/ the bend, PRO-M sells a maf for such, one of the questions they ask upon purchase is if your maf is before or after the bend, my pro-m maf worked fine due to the fact it was calibrated for a CAI Smile
